Sound Quality of Fenton Record Player

When it comes to record players, sound quality is one of the most important factors to consider. After all, the whole point of playing vinyl records is to enjoy the warm, rich sound that they produce. So, is Fenton a good record player when it comes to sound quality?

First, it’s important to note that Fenton is a budget brand. This means that their record players are generally priced lower than those from more established brands like Audio-Technica or Pro-Ject. As a result, you might expect the sound quality to be lower as well.

However, that’s not necessarily the case. While Fenton record players may not have all the bells and whistles of more expensive models, they can still produce a decent sound. Of course, the quality of the sound will depend on a number of factors, including the quality of the record itself, the speakers you’re using, and the environment you’re listening in.

One thing to keep in mind is that Fenton record players typically have built-in speakers. While this can be convenient, it can also limit the sound quality. Built-in speakers are generally not as powerful or high-quality as external speakers, so if you’re looking for the best possible sound, you may want to consider investing in a separate set of speakers.

Another factor to consider is the type of cartridge that comes with the Fenton record player. The cartridge is the part of the turntable that holds the needle, and it plays a big role in determining the sound quality. Fenton record players typically come with a ceramic cartridge, which is a lower-end option. While ceramic cartridges can produce decent sound, they’re not as accurate or detailed as higher-end options like moving magnet or moving coil cartridges.

That being said, you can always upgrade the cartridge on your Fenton record player if you want to improve the sound quality. Just be aware that this will add to the overall cost of the turntable.

Overall, while Fenton record players may not be the best option for audiophiles or serious music enthusiasts, they can still produce a decent sound. If you’re on a budget and just looking for a basic record player to enjoy your vinyl collection, a Fenton model could be a good choice. Just be aware of the limitations and consider upgrading the speakers or cartridge if you want to improve the sound quality.
